Sections by Teach My now give customers the ability to create their own learning program for kids by allowing them to pick different parts from all of the Teach My kits.  This is fantastic for a toddler that may have mastered numbers and doesn’t need the basics from the Teach My Toddler set but instead may need the numbers from the Teach My Preschooler set, for example. ($14.99-$19.99)

Teach My is also coming out with Add-Ons which will give customers the ability to remove a section from a Teach My kit and replace it with an Add-On instead.  The first Add-On from Teach My is now available.  The Solar System from Teach My is for ages 18m+ and gives children the foundation for learning about the sun and planets.  I know Elijah would have loved this as a toddler!

Teach My Baby kits can be used starting at about 6 months of age, and the Teach My Preschooler kits take your child right up to Kindergarten readiness.  When looking at great gift ideas for little ones this year, and perhaps wondering what else you can get a child that already has a multitude of toys, Teach My is a gift that will be used far after the batteries run out on the Christmas morning toys.
